  • 7,500 km of BOT highway projects at risk: CRISIL

    According to CRISIL Ratings, around 7,500 km of highway projects -- 5,100 km under construction and 2,400 km operational – awarded mostly between fiscals 2010 and 2012 on a build, operate, transfer, or BOT, basis, are at high risk today. "But recent government initiatives, lower interest rates can stem further slippage", says the report.

  • Highway projects worth Rs 67,000 crore at high risk: Crisil

    Around 50 per cent of the projects under-construction are at high risk of not being completed because of significant cost over-runs and weak wherewithal of sponsors.

  • Urea makers stare at delayed subsidies, gas trouble: CRISIL

    While the SBA does provide temporary respite to fertiliser manufacturers in the form of cash-flow relief and lower interest burden, CRISIL believes the problem of under-budgeting, especially when the urea subsidy bill is likely to bloat in the next fiscal, will need to be addressed.

  • Telcos' profit growth to double in 2 years: CRISIL

    Telecom: Revenue contribution from data and value-added services could touch 20 per cent in the medium term from 16 per cent in the last fiscal with large telecom players having seen data usage more than doubling in the first half of this fiscal, year-on-year, says CRISIL Ratings.

  • Fertiliser subsidy unlikely to reduce: CRISIL

    CRISIL believes that the Government of India's (GoI's) fertiliser subsidy is unlikely to reduce even after new plants are set up under the New Urea Investment Policy (NIP) 2013.
